Schools’ Pride Week is kicking off this week, with more than 200 schools set to participate, despite fears of pushback and protests.
LGBTQ+ charity InsideOUT’s managing director Tabby Besley said they were aiming to combat the “alarming rise in transphobia, homophobia, and anti-rainbow hate”.
The week begins today and lasts until Friday and activities already advertised by some schools include rainbow bracelet making, rainbow bake sales and colourful mufti days.
Besley said it was a “hard balance” between the risk of protests and keeping tamariki safe while celebrating them.
She said there have already been numerous disinformation and defamation campaigns by “well-known anti-rainbow hate groups and ultra-conservative organisations”.

Students at Auckland’s Hobsonville Point Secondary School were left devastated recently after an LGBTQ+ event was cancelled after protest threats.
One student, who wished to remain anonymous, told the Herald they were “disheartened” and “angry”.
“It’s a really important event for the community because it helps people feel less alone and have a place to share experiences,” they said.
“It generally improves people’s mental health so much.”
New Zealand has seen a backlash against the rainbow community during the past year.

Last year, a Destiny Church member vandalised Karangahape Rd’s rainbow crossing in Auckland, and several drag story-time events were forced to be cancelled after threats.
In February, Destiny Church members stormed Te AtatÅ« library during a drag artist’s science show.
A 16-year-old girl attending a sports event suffered a concussion after being assaulted during the violent melee.
